How they compare
Macau, China currently reports 98.2% against 92.1% in SDG: Northern Africa, a difference of 6.1%.
That makes Macau, China's figure about 1.1 times SDG: Northern Africa's.
Across all 24 years both countries report, Macau, China has been ahead every year.
Macau, China ranks 90th and SDG: Northern Africa ranks 88th of 199 countries.
Macau, China has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Macau, China | SDG: Northern Africa |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 106.2% | 80.1% | 26.1% | Macau, China |
| 2010s | 104.9% | 87.7% | 17.2% | Macau, China |
| 2020s | 94.4% | 89.5% | 4.9% | Macau, China |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
